WASHINGTON -- The nation's capital is the country's fifth-largest supermarket market, with total sales of $8.86 billion, according to Sales and Marketing Management.
The region is dominated by Landover, Md.-based Giant Food Inc., now a unit of Ahold USA Inc. Giant, with 116 stores in the area, holds a 37% share. Safeway Inc., with 99 outlets, trails distantly with 20% of the market. Other supermarket players in the capitol include Shoppers Food Warehouse/Metro, the Food Lion chain of Delhaize America and the Fresh Fields unit of Whole Foods Market Inc.
